    My system has recently been crashing. I suspect it may be faulty ram since it typically crashes during memory intensive activities such as Burning, Video, etc.

    I have attached the zipped dumps and hope that someone could review for me to either confirm suspicions or send me in the right direction.

    The first thing you do, then, if you can keep it running, is to download and run MemTest86 free version and run it for four hours or 7 passes, whichever is longer. If you have memory problems MemTest will likely find the cause or location.
